Output 77e606d55bfc58ed63fc198430179f08035f6e7c7e89fc79d71cbb1195ce4f25:0
- value
- 8706000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de28e9dd3a24e242b5ee6e49fcda4c9604299166 OP_EQUAL
- address
- 3MwgwrNrSJd8bfNQhp36RaCjbBUzctYJ7V
- transaction
- 77e606d55bfc58ed63fc198430179f08035f6e7c7e89fc79d71cbb1195ce4f25